Profile

The Senior Account Manager has responsibility for managing and growing the client relationship on one or more accounts under the direction of a VP, Client Partner. The Senior Account Manager provides client and project team leadership, develops mid-senior level client relationships and is regarded by the client as a trusted advisor. The Senior Account Manager serves as the leader of a specific Critical Mass project team, which partners with a specific vertical client set. He or she is responsible for client satisfaction, account revenue growth, and overall business profitability in services delivery.
You Will:
Manage project relationship with select client organization
Be responsible for the success and satisfaction of individual client relationship(s)
Build relationships with senior managers within client organization
Be responsible for client satisfaction, while targeting 100% client reference-ability
Lead projects/initiatives to conclusion/delivery
Create opportunities for deeper collaboration and interaction and reinforce the client’s status as an innovative participant in the creation of cutting-edge solutions
Understand all disciplines enough to provide a quality assurance check of project deliverables and have a point of view of best practices and solutions across functions
Provide leadership, support and ongoing guidance to members of the project team
Provide Critical Mass’ internal teams with appropriate insight into client’s strategic business initiatives
Have a point of view on industry structure, trends, initiatives, and issues
Have a point of view of best practices and solutions across functions
Provide Critical Mass’ Executive Sponsor, VP, Client Partner or Account Director with insights into organizational opportunities for cross and up-sell opportunities
Oversee the development of detailed proposals and statements of work with the support of core team members including an Account Director, VP, Client Partner or member of the executive management team.
Significantly grow the client relationship in terms of revenue generated and account profitability
Proactively sell and manage customer expectations and communicate project and profit risks to Critical Mass team and client
You Have:
5 years of Account Management experience in an Internet Marketing or Advertising Online Media
Experience working with complex clients delivering annual services revenues in excess of $2MM each
Experience with integrated, digital and social-first campaign development, strategy and production
Experience working as part of an Inter-Agency Team model, partnering with media, brand, and PR agencies to deliver full-funnel campaigns
Ability to work with strategists, data analysts and media partners to facilitate an on-going test-and-learn environment
Financial services and B2B background is a plus
Bachelor’s degree or higher in one of the following areas: business, marketing, communications, e-business engineering, Aor computer science
Demonstrated understanding of Customer Relationship Management, Content Management, Analytics, Digital Marketing, eCommerce, and Internet Technologies
Knowledge of programs, projects and knowledge management processes and toolsets
Demonstrated skills in negotiation and leadership
Demonstrated excellence in written and oral communications, including outstanding presentation skills
A comprehensive and detailed knowledge of issues within e-business, which includes a strong working knowledge of third-party solution providers
Demonstrated excellence in interpersonal skills, especially in situations involving consensus and team building with strong problem-solving skills related to program and account management
Ability to handle multiple tasks simultaneously
Team orientation, particularly working with remote or decentralized team
Keen sense of creative thinking and problem solving
